“  I am interested in family, equality, and constitutional law. My first book "Legal Recognition of Non-Conjugal Couples: New Frontiers in Family Law in the US, Canada and Europe" was published by Hart in 2021. A new book "Queer and Religious Alliances in Family Law Politics and Beyond", co-edited with Jeffrey A. Redding, appeared in the Law and Society series at Anthem Press (2022).  ”
